Meloni Government Suspends Schengen Agreement with Spain Following Migration Crisis in Ceuta

Italy will require passport checks for air and sea arrivals from Spain after a surge of about 60,000 migrants into Ceuta, officials said.

  • On Friday, Italian Prime Minister Giorgia Meloni suspended Schengen free-movement rules for arrivals from Spain, requiring passport checks for air and sea travel following a mass influx of irregular migrants into the Spanish enclave of Ceuta from Morocco.
  • Spanish authorities reported over 50,000 crossings at the Ceuta border this week, with officials recovering 57 bodies on the Spanish side as migrants attempted to breach coastal barriers and fences into the territory.
  • Meloni's government, facing electoral pressure from retired general Roberto Vannacci's far-right party, implemented the controls to demonstrate border security. Democratic Party MP Piero De Luca dismissed the move as "a purely demagogic proposal" intended "for domestic consumption."
  • Italy's interior ministry reached an agreement with France to strengthen controls along their shared land border to prevent irregular migrants from entering Italy, while France increased checks on its border with Spain.
  • President Donald Trump warned of similar outcomes in the U.S. if current policies persist, while right-wing parties across Europe blamed Spain's amnesty programs for unauthorized migrants as a root cause of the surge.
